If you're prone to binge, don't start watching the MAX show "Warrior". The plot will grab you from the start, and won't let go. Ah Sam, the central character, is a skilled martial artist who sails to 1870's San Francisco in search of his lost sister. From the moment he exits the boat, Ah Sam quickly becomes embroiled in the battles and political machinations between the tongs, politicians, cops, and labor unions who run the city.

Like "The Wire", "Warrior" does a great job of showing how the incentives of the key players drive their behavior--very few of the characters are wholly good or bad. All of the factions have their angels and their demons. "Banshee" show runner Jonathon Tropper is also the show runner for "Warrior". And like "Banshee", "Warrior" intersperses the political intrigue with fist fights, gun battles, and fights with bladed weapons of all kinds. (If you're squeamish about sex and violence, this probably isn't the show for you. )

In addition to Ah Sam, there's a rich cast of secondary characters. Chao, the arms dealer who sells weapons to all sides. Lee, the wet behind the ears Southern cop. Ah Toy, a Chinatown madam. No matter how minor, you care about them and feel scared when they're in trouble, and sad when they die.

IMO, one of the best shows on TV right now.

The third season premiered on June 29, 2023.
